APPOINTMENT OF INDEPENDENT MEMBERS OF THE COUNCIL’S STANDARDS COMMITTEE

 

 

 

The Local Government Act 2000 required the Council to establish a Standards Committee and required that at least one quarter of the membership of that Committee was independent of the Council.  The Council had decided that the councillor membership would be six, and therefore two independent members would need to be appointed.  The Council had decided to establish a Standards Committee for the municipal year 2001/02 but, without the necessary independent members, it had not yet met.  The independent members had to be appointed by full Council.

 

 

 

The Sub-Committee interviewed four applicants for the position of independent member of the Standards Committee.  The Council was recommended that

 

 

 

(i)

following the interview of the applicants and the further clarification sought, the appointment of one independent member of the Standards Committee be made; and    

 

 

 

(ii)

further interest in the position of independent member be invited.
